Factors to Consider When Choosing Camera Gloves for Cold Weather Shooting
When you’re selecting camera gloves for cold weather shooting, several key factors come into play. You’ll want to prioritize insulation, dexterity, and features like waterproofing and touchscreen compatibility. Additionally, consider grip and durability to guarantee you can capture the perfect shot without sacrificing comfort.
Insulation and Warmth
Choosing the right camera gloves for cold weather shooting means prioritizing insulation and warmth. Look for gloves made with high-quality materials like 3M Thinsulate, which can keep your hands warm in temperatures as low as -20°F. Plush fleece backing adds extra thermal insulation and comfort, vital for those long outdoor sessions. It’s also important to choose gloves with windproof and water-repellent properties, blocking cold air and moisture effectively. A snug fit is essential, so opt for gloves with adjustable wrist straps or cuffs to retain body heat. While warmth is key, make sure your gloves allow for enough finger mobility, so you can operate your camera controls without sacrificing comfort. Stay warm and focused on capturing stunning photos!
Dexterity and Finger Mobility
While staying warm is essential during cold weather shooting, maintaining dexterity and finger mobility is equally important for capturing those perfect shots. Look for gloves with convertible designs that let you flip back finger caps, allowing for enhanced dexterity while keeping your hands warm. Gloves featuring tri-cut or segmented finger designs make it easier to manipulate settings and operate buttons without removing them. Touchscreen compatibility is vital, so you can use your smartphone or camera without exposing your fingers to the cold. Additionally, silicone or reinforced palms provide a secure grip for handling your camera, especially in slippery conditions. Opt for insulation materials like 3M Thinsulate, which offer warmth without bulk, ensuring you retain control for precise camera work.
Waterproof and Windproof Features
Maintaining dexterity is essential, but you can’t overlook the importance of waterproof and windproof features in camera gloves for cold weather shooting. Waterproof gloves keep moisture from seeping in, ensuring your hands stay dry and warm while handling your gear. When it’s blustery outside, windproof features help block cold air, reducing heat loss and keeping you comfortable.
Look for gloves made with high-performance materials like neoprene or specialized fabrics that offer both waterproof and windproof protection without sacrificing your finger mobility. Sealed seams and waterproof membranes enhance the gloves’ ability to fend off unexpected rain or snow. Additionally, choosing gloves with a breathable waterproof layer helps regulate temperature and prevents sweat buildup, allowing for extended wear without discomfort.

Size and Fit
When selecting camera gloves for cold weather shooting, finding the right size and fit is essential for both comfort and functionality. Proper sizing guarantees your gloves fit snugly without being too tight, allowing for dexterity while handling your equipment. To choose the correct size, measure around the widest part of your palm and refer to the manufacturer’s sizing chart. If you’re between sizes, opt for the larger size for added comfort and to accommodate layers underneath. Look for adjustable wrist straps to enhance fit, keeping cold air out and guaranteeing a secure grip on your gear. Remember, a loose fit can hinder dexterity, so prioritize gloves that offer finger mobility along with warmth and insulation.
